"Roland Barthes by Roland Barthes" is a unique and introspective work published in 1975, where the renowned French theorist turns his analytical gaze inward. This book is an unconventional autobiography that blends personal reflections with theoretical insights, showcasing Barthes' innovative approach to self-representation. Unlike traditional autobiographies, "Roland Barthes by Roland Barthes" does not follow a linear narrative. Instead, it is organized into short fragments, each providing glimpses into Barthes' thoughts, experiences, and intellectual journey. These fragments cover a wide range of topics, including his childhood, academic career, personal relationships, and reflections on language and literature. Barthes uses these vignettes to explore how identity is constructed and represented, both in life and in writing.
